Student Loan Scams Can Be Avoided in Several Ways

Now, let’s talk about those other shady mailings you receive regularly. Some businesses will go to any length to get your money, including offering to do things for you that you could do yourself (such as enrolling in income-driven repayment) or making outrageous promises to pay off your student loan debt if you pay a fee. Here are some questions to ask if you’re not sure if a mailing you received is a scam.

1. Is it true that they want your money? Are they requesting a fee to consolidate your loans or a monthly payment to have your loans forgiven?

2. Is it possible that they are offering to do things for you that you could do yourself? Do you want to refinance or consolidate your debt or apply for Income-Based Repayment? 3. Are they making promises that they can’t keep? Are they, for example, claiming that they can get your loans forgiven? Although the federal government offers some student loan forgiveness programs, all of them have stringent eligibility requirements and can take decades to implement.

4. Do they want your personal information? For example, what is your account number, FSA number, or even power of attorney? Don’t give the fraudsters your information because your legitimate loan servicer already has it.

You can quickly find out if Great Lakes is your loan servicer by searching My Federal Student Aid or the NSLDS database or by calling them. Knowing who your loan servicer is will help you decide which mail to open and which to discard.

What Are Your Options for Making Monthly Payments at Great Lakes?

1. Payments made via the internet

You can easily make payments online if you are a federal borrower designated Great Lakes as your service provider. You’ll need to register for mygreatlakes.org and create an account on the online portal. You will be asked for personal information such as your name, date of birth, social security number, etc. After that, you can get information about your loan. You will be given an account and given a username and password to log in to mygreatlakes.org. You can download the mobile application and use your debit card to organize payments. There is no way to pay with a credit card.

2. Pay with a check

Each month, you can send a check or money order to Great Lakes and have it emailed to you. Naturally, this will necessitate a reminder and will take some time.

3. Auto-pay

You can set up an automatic payment option to ensure that your payments are regularly deducted from your bank account and that you are notified. You get a 0.25 percent interest rate reduction on all direct loans you repay this way. You’re also unlikely to default on payments and incur a penalty. You can easily change the amount deducted from your account by signing up.

Problems Associated with Great Lakes Student Loans

Great Lakes has a low number of complaints with the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au (CFPB) when compared to other loan servicers. However, between March 2017 and March 2018, the servicer received only 310 complaints, compared to Navient’s 3,599. The Better Business Bureau has given Great Lakes an A+ rating. Despite this, the servicer has received three primary complaints from borrowers. The following are some of the most common Great Lakes complaints:

5. The issue with how payments are handled

The majority of borrower complaints revolve around payment issues, such as payment misallocation, false reporting of late payments, and difficulties making extra payments. According to the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au, all issues were resolved on time. Even if you sign up for autopay, it’s important to keep track of your monthly payments when working with any servicer.

6. Receiving incorrect loan information

Another common complaint is that borrowers are receiving incorrect loan information, particularly when attempting to file for deferment and forbearance. It’s crucial to keep track of your payments and requests, especially if you’re trying to stop payments. When you’re having problems with your account, it’s best to contact the servicer as soon as possible.

7. Can’t get other flexible options for repaying loans

Borrowers are having difficulty changing repayment plans with Great Lakes, or the company has not properly switched its repayment plan. The best way to deal with this is to keep track of your repayment plan switching process, including the date you filed for and received confirmation. Then, contact Great Lakes to get everything sorted out as soon as possible with that information.
